Understand Chlorine's Role in Water Treatment

Chlorine is a common chemical used in water treatment processes to kill bacteria and improve hygiene standards. It effectively eliminates harmful pathogens, making water safe for drinking and household use. However, while chlorine plays a vital role in ensuring clean water, it can also contribute to an unpleasant taste and odor, often leading people to wonder how to get rid of chlorine in well water or lower chlorine in tap water.

Explore Common Chlorine Removal Methods

Many homeowners face the challenge of cloudy water caused by high levels of chlorine, often from local water treatment systems. Exploring effective chlorine removal methods is essential for achieving clear, safe drinking water. The market offers various solutions, including top-rated chlorine removers that cater to different needs and preferences.
Common techniques involve using eco-friendly chlorine removers, such as carbon filters or reverse osmosis systems. Carbon filters are highly effective at reducing chlorine levels by adsorbing the chemical onto their surface. Reverse osmosis, on the other hand, uses a semi-permeable membrane to filter out contaminants, including chlorine. Understanding how these chlorine removal systems work is crucial in selecting the best solution for your home.
Evaluate Filter Options for Effective Chlorine Reduction

When it comes to evaluating filter options for effective chlorine removal, it's crucial to understand that different systems cater to various needs and water sources. The first step is to determine the specific type of chlorine in your water—whether it's free chlorine or total chlorine—as this will influence your choice of filter media. For instance, activated carbon filters are highly effective at removing free chlorine, making them a popular choice for treating pool water. These filters work by physically trapping chlorine molecules as water passes through the carbon grains.
For those seeking a best value chlorine removal solution, reverse osmosis (RO) systems offer a comprehensive chlorine-free shower filter option. RO technology effectively removes not only chlorine but also other contaminants like heavy metals and total dissolved solids. While initially more expensive than activated carbon filters, RO systems provide long-lasting performance and superior water quality, making them a worthy investment in the long run.
